The Behavior of Weighted Graph’s Orbit and Its Energy

Ali A. Shukur, Akbar Jahanbani and Haider Shelash

Mathematical Problems in Engineering, 2021, vol. 2021, 1-6

Abstract:

Studying the orbit of an element in a discrete dynamical system is one of the most important areas in pure and applied mathematics. It is well known that each graph contains a finite (or infinite) number of elements. In this work, we introduce a new analytical phenomenon to the weighted graphs by studying the orbit of their elements. Studying the weighted graph's orbit allows us to have a better understanding to the behaviour of the systems (graphs) during determined time and environment. Moreover, the energy of the graph’s orbit is given.
